    That little "a" with a circle around it is most commonly used as the "at" symbol. The symbol is usually

found in e-mail addresses. Surprisingly though, there is no official (官方的) name for this symbol, there

are lots of strange ways to describe the @ symbol. Before the @ symbol became the popular symbol for e-mail, it was used to show the cost of something. For example, if you bought 6 apples, you might write

6 apples @$1.10 each.

    As e-mail is becoming more and more popular, the@symbol or the"at sign is used between a person's

online user name and his mail server address, for example, joe@126.com. The symbol's use on the

Internet made it necessary for people to put this symbol on keyboards in the countries that had never seen or used the symbol before.      

    The actual origin (起源) of the @ symbol remains a mystery. According to an ancient western legend, during the Middle Ages before the invention of the printing press (印刷机), every letter of a word had

to be written by hand for each copy of a book. The monks (僧侣) looked for ways to make the letters

of common words less. Although the word "at" was quite short, it was quite a common word in texts and

documents. As a result, they circled around "a" and created @.
